
Haoning Xi is currently a Ph.D. candidate at the Research Centre for Integrated Transport Innovation (RCITI) | University of New South Wales, (UNSW Sydney), and she was also a co-cultured Ph.D. student in Optimization and Financial Risk Analysis research group|Data61, Commonwealth Scientific and Industrial Research Organization (CSIRO), Australia. Her research interests include transportation economics, mobility as a service, shared mobility, optimization theory, and algorithm design. Before that, she got her Master's degree from Tsinghua University, China, and her Bachelor's degree from Central South University, China. She was a research assistant at UC Berkeley and a visiting postgraduate in HKUST. She was a summer intern at Accenture Shenzhen Global Innovation hub.
